⚠️ Size Note: Barb size refers to the inner diameter of the tubing it is designed to fit. Measure your tubing's inner bore before ordering. If you are between sizes, generally size down for a tighter, more secure barb grip.

How do I choose the right hose barb size for my tubing?

Match the barb diameter to your tubing's inner diameter (ID). For example, a 1.6mm (≈1/16") barb fits tubing with a 1.6mm inner bore; a 6.4mm (≈1/4") barb fits 1/4" ID tubing. When in doubt, size down slightly — a snug fit generally seals better than a loose one and reduces the chance of the tubing slipping off the barb.

What is the difference between male and female luer lock fittings?

A male luer lock has an external thread collar that twists onto a female luer port (such as a syringe barrel or female luer cap). A female luer lock has an internal thread that accepts a male luer tip. They are designed to mate together for a secure, leak-resistant connection. Choose the type that matches the port on your existing equipment.

Do I need any tools to install these fittings?

No tools are required. The luer lock thread is designed for hand-tightening. Push the barb tail firmly into your flexible tubing, then twist the luer collar onto the mating port until snug. For a more secure barb-to-tubing seal, a small amount of tubing lubricant or a hose clamp can be used, but is typically not necessary for low-pressure applications.

Which barb size should I order for 3/32" ID tubing?

3/32" is approximately 2.4mm. Select the 2.4mm barb size for the closest match to 3/32" inner diameter tubing. Similarly: 1/16" ≈ 1.6mm, 5/32" ≈ 3.9mm, 3/16" ≈ 4.8mm, 7/32" ≈ 5.6mm, 1/4" ≈ 6.4mm.
